Got 39.94 m.p.g. calculated , display 39.6 . This included 3 passengers and some cargo of about 30 lbs. for about 200 miles of the 333.8 miles at fillup of VALERO 87 w/ E10 , which was the previous fill . Use same pump for past / present fills . The gas gauge was a little under 1/4 of a tank . The tires are set at 35 p.s.i. and there were many steep hills on this tank . Very pleased . This is doing just as well as the 2010 3 door w/ power package and 4 speed auto that was traded in towards the FIT . The FIT is the 5 speed auto and weighs about 150 lbs. more than the 3 door . There's about 4,700 miles on it .
